In watching the game on Sunday it has become very clear to me that those complaining about Keenum's arm are dead on the money right.
While he is very competent and a good field general his arm betrays him greatly.
Two examples of where his arm cost the Rams touchdowns on Sunday are as follows.
1. Lance Kendricks getting behind the defense for a long gainer down to the 4 yard line. If that pass has more zip on it there is no doubt in my view that Kendricks scores.
2. Same series down by the goal line. The pass to Kenny Britt. if that ball is thrown sooner and on time Britt scores instead of the pass being incomplete.
There was another pass where I believe it was Austin was open down in the redzone in the 1st quarter and Keenum over threw him badly.
You can't beat Keenum for his knowledge and leadership and competency but his arm betrays him. You probably as a head coach have to start Case next week but the writing is pretty clear now. He's going to be replaced by Goff at somepoint this season. Much of that depends on Goff getting up to speed and being able to run the offense and manage the offense effectively.
